#9a6a67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9a6a67 is composed of 60.4% red, 41.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 33.1%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 3.5 degrees, a saturation of 20.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#9a6a67 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d4ce with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#9a6a67 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#9a6a67 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9a6a67 has RGB values of R:154, G:106,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.33,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10119783.

Shades and Tints of #9a6a67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9a6a67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877b7a is the less saturated color, while #fb1406 is the most saturated one.
